Transaction

5f355dc906ae0add3a73b09eecaf2b73efaa354be055d57caf7b35e8a586e585
537,643 confirmations
Timestamp
1458321190
Block403,239
Fee15,000 sats
Fee rate66.7 sats/vB
view on mempool.space

Inputs & Outputs